fixed: build error

This commit is contained in:
LittleBoy 2024-08-09 13:03:27 +08:00
parent 5b622543b9
commit 35dacc0f06
4 changed files with 8 additions and 9 deletions

View File

@ -1,6 +1,6 @@
import {Card} from "@/components/card"; import {Card} from "@/components/card";
import {useSetState} from "ahooks"; import {useSetState} from "ahooks";
import {Button, Space, Spin, TagInput, Toast} from "@douyinfe/semi-ui"; import {Button, Space, TagInput, Toast} from "@douyinfe/semi-ui";
import {useTranslation} from "react-i18next"; import {useTranslation} from "react-i18next";
import {useEffect} from "react"; import {useEffect} from "react";
import {getPermissionList, savePermissionList} from "@/service/api/user.ts"; import {getPermissionList, savePermissionList} from "@/service/api/user.ts";
@ -81,7 +81,7 @@ const Permission = ()=>{
</div>))} </div>))}
<Space> <Space>
<Button loading={state.loading} onClick={saveRoles} theme={'solid'}>{state.loading ? 'Loading' :t('base.save')}</Button> <Button loading={state.loading} onClick={saveRoles} theme={'solid'}>{state.loading ? 'Loading' :t('base.save')}</Button>
<div>{state.message||''}</div> {/*<div>{state.message||''}</div>*/}
</Space> </Space>
</Card>) </Card>)
} }

View File

@ -1,4 +1,3 @@
import {BillDetailItems} from "@/components/bill";
import {Button, Col, Form, Modal, Row, Select, Space} from "@douyinfe/semi-ui"; import {Button, Col, Form, Modal, Row, Select, Space} from "@douyinfe/semi-ui";
import React from "react"; import React from "react";
import {useTranslation} from "react-i18next"; import {useTranslation} from "react-i18next";
@ -23,6 +22,7 @@ export const AddBillModal: React.FC<BillPaidModalProps> = (props) => {
setState({ setState({
loading: true loading: true
}) })
console.log(values)
} }
return (<> return (<>
<Button onClick={()=>setState({open:true})} theme={'solid'}>{t('bill.import_bill')}</Button> <Button onClick={()=>setState({open:true})} theme={'solid'}>{t('bill.import_bill')}</Button>
@ -40,9 +40,9 @@ export const AddBillModal: React.FC<BillPaidModalProps> = (props) => {
<Form<BillUpdateParams> onSubmit={onSubmit} initValues={{ <Form<BillUpdateParams> onSubmit={onSubmit} initValues={{
payment_channel: 'FLYWIRE', payment_channel: 'FLYWIRE',
payment_method: '', payment_method: '',
merchant_ref: props.bill?.merchant_ref, merchant_ref: '',
payment_amount: props.bill?.amount, payment_amount: '',
actual_payment_amount: props.bill?.amount actual_payment_amount: '',
}}> }}>
<Row gutter={20}> <Row gutter={20}>
<Col span={12}> <Col span={12}>

View File

@ -1,4 +1,4 @@
import {Button, Select, Space, Divider, InputNumber, Modal, Toast} from "@douyinfe/semi-ui"; import {Button, Select, Space, Divider, InputNumber, Modal,} from "@douyinfe/semi-ui";
import React, {useMemo} from "react"; import React, {useMemo} from "react";
import {useSetState} from "ahooks"; import {useSetState} from "ahooks";
import MoneyFormat from "@/components/money-format.tsx"; import MoneyFormat from "@/components/money-format.tsx";
@ -113,7 +113,6 @@ const BillTypeConfirmItem = (props: { data: BillDetail; onChange: (confirms: Con
} }
export const BillTypeConfirm: React.FC<BillTypeConfirmProps> = (props) => { export const BillTypeConfirm: React.FC<BillTypeConfirmProps> = (props) => {
const {t} = useTranslation()
const [state, setState] = useSetState<{ const [state, setState] = useSetState<{
confirm_application_number: string; confirm_application_number: string;
confirmed: { confirmed: {

View File

@ -23,7 +23,7 @@ export const NumberConfirm: React.FC<NumberConfirmProps> = ({bill, type, onChang
onChange(confirmNumber) onChange(confirmNumber)
} }
useEffect(() => { useEffect(() => {
const confirmNumber = (type == 'application_number' ? (bill.application_number_confirm || bill.application_number) : bill.student_number) || ''; const confirmNumber = (type == 'application_number' ? (bill.confirm_application_number || bill.application_number) : bill.student_number) || '';
onValueChange(confirmNumber) onValueChange(confirmNumber)
}, []) }, [])